on URL http://www.sax.de/~adlibit/e3-2.42.tar.gz

you will find another release of e3 text editor:
GPL source code and binaries including ELKS.


e3 is a NASM-assembler written micro (XXXS) text editor for 
several 16 bit and 32 bit platforms (including Linux, ELKS, 
*BSD, Atheos, QNX, Win32, DOS) on x86 and on ARM CPU.
e3 can act in wordstar/emacs/vi/pico/nedit emulations.

The 16bit versions for ELKS and DOS on 8086 or 286 CPU ("e3-16")
are limited to the wordstar key set.


ELKS release note: 
 a bug was fixed, just now e3-16 is able 
 to run on native 8086 16 bit CPUs, that was 
 tested using ELKS 0.1 running on a 1986 built PC.
